Job Description

Responsible for providing assistance to special education teachers; assists in the instruction, medical, and health needs of special education students; provides some clerical support; may provide assistance with a variety of daily functions such as behavior support as well as life skills instruction; implement daily and long range lessons; assists students with daily functions such as food preparation, hand over hand or tube feeding, toileting; etc. Collaborates and consults with special needs team and other specialists. Develops and promotes good community relations among various community members and school clientele.

Experience in an educational environment preferred; verbal and written communication skills in English and a demonstrated ability to read and comprehend written/graphic and oral instructions; computer skills word processing; database and spreadsheets. The location of this position is based on student need and is subject to change as needed.

Essential Physical Requirements

  • Occasional lifting of forty (40) to seventy (70) pounds
  • Frequent bending, standing, sitting, and walking
  • Occasional reaching, kneeling, bending, squatting, and standing
  • Ability to run short distances

Responsibilities

Position Specific Information (if Applicable):

May be responsible for classroom supervision in the absence of the teacher.

May assist and escort student in bus transference, which may involve lifting children and/or equipment. May provide assistance to students in non-classroom settings.

Communicate with parents and other school personnel as needed.

Respect confidentiality regarding student needs and abilities.

Document health related services in designated Medicaid documentation system for the DCSD School Medicaid Reimbursement Program as assigned.

Support daily and long range lessons and activities under the direction of a certified teacher to meet Individual Education Plan (IEP) goals.

Assist students with daily functions such as food preparation, hand over hand or tube feeding, toileting, etc., as well as life skills instructions.

Collaborate and consult with special needs team and other specialists on various activities, planning, and resource allocations.

Administer and document prescription medication to students and perform medical procedures.

Perform other related duties as assigned or requested.

May provide assistance in some therapeutic activities as prescribed by therapist and assist in documentation of progress and services.
